Jak zduplikować zaznaczony wiersz w DBGrid?

0

Witam, zastanawiam się jak zduplikować zaznaczony w dbgridzie wiersz, zeby dodal sie do dbgrida z autoinkrementalnym numerem ID.

Czy ktoś spotykał się z takim problemem, jakieś propozycje?

0

DBGrid nie przechowuje danych. Tego typu operację musisz wykonać na query, a nie dbgrid. Na query oczywiście coś takiego się da zrobić jeśli zaznaczysz rekord to robisz query.insert wstawiasz dane i pobierasz np z sekwencji bazodanowej kolejny numer wstawiając go w konkretną kolumnę. Na końcu musisz zrobić jeszcze query.post i (w zależności od dystrybucji bazy danych) commit na bazie danych jeśli chcesz te dane zapisać w bazie.

1 użytkowników online, w tym zalogowanych: 0, gości: 1